Interface DeleteIntegrationRequest.Builder
-
- All Superinterfaces:
AwsRequest.Builder
,Buildable
,CloudWatchLogsRequest.Builder
,CopyableBuilder<DeleteIntegrationRequest.Builder,DeleteIntegrationRequest>
,SdkBuilder<DeleteIntegrationRequest.Builder,DeleteIntegrationRequest>
,SdkPojo
,SdkRequest.Builder
- Enclosing class:
- DeleteIntegrationRequest
public static interface DeleteIntegrationRequest.Builder extends CloudWatchLogsRequest.Builder, SdkPojo, CopyableBuilder<DeleteIntegrationRequest.Builder,DeleteIntegrationRequest>
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description DeleteIntegrationRequest.Builder
force(Boolean force)
Specifytrue
to force the deletion of the integration even if vended logs dashboards currently exist.DeleteIntegrationRequest.Builder
integrationName(String integrationName)
The name of the integration to delete.DeleteIntegrationRequest.Builder
overrideConfiguration(Consumer<AwsRequestOverrideConfiguration.Builder> builderConsumer)
DeleteIntegrationRequest.Builder
overrideConfiguration(AwsRequestOverrideConfiguration overrideConfiguration)
-
Methods inherited from interface software.amazon.awssdk.awscore.AwsRequest.Builder
overrideConfiguration
-
Methods inherited from interface software.amazon.awssdk.services.cloudwatchlogs.model.CloudWatchLogsRequest.Builder
build
-
Methods inherited from interface software.amazon.awssdk.utils.builder.CopyableBuilder
copy
-
Methods inherited from interface software.amazon.awssdk.utils.builder.SdkBuilder
applyMutation, build
-
Methods inherited from interface software.amazon.awssdk.core.SdkPojo
equalsBySdkFields, sdkFieldNameToField, sdkFields
-
-
-
-
Method Detail
-
integrationName
DeleteIntegrationRequest.Builder integrationName(String integrationName)
The name of the integration to delete. To find the name of your integration, use ListIntegrations.
- Parameters:
integrationName
- The name of the integration to delete. To find the name of your integration, use ListIntegrations.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
force
DeleteIntegrationRequest.Builder force(Boolean force)
Specify
true
to force the deletion of the integration even if vended logs dashboards currently exist.The default is
false
.- Parameters:
force
- Specifytrue
to force the deletion of the integration even if vended logs dashboards currently exist.The default is
false
.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
overrideConfiguration
DeleteIntegrationRequest.Builder overrideConfiguration(AwsRequestOverrideConfiguration overrideConfiguration)
- Specified by:
overrideConfiguration
in interfaceAwsRequest.Builder
-
overrideConfiguration
DeleteIntegrationRequest.Builder overrideConfiguration(Consumer<AwsRequestOverrideConfiguration.Builder> builderConsumer)
- Specified by:
overrideConfiguration
in interfaceAwsRequest.Builder
-
-